The Benefits and Risks of Using Mobile Banking Apps

Mobile banking apps have become increasingly popular in recent years, providing customers with easy and convenient access to their financial information. While there are many benefits to using mobile banking apps, there are also some risks that users should be aware of. In this article, we’ll explore the benefits and risks of using mobile banking apps.

Benefits of Using Mobile Banking Apps

Mobile banking apps offer a variety of benefits to users, including:

  • Convenient access to account information, balances, and transaction history
  • Ability to transfer funds between accounts and pay bills
  • Quick and easy check deposit using your mobile device’s camera
  • Real-time alerts for account activity and suspicious transactions
  • Enhanced security features, such as biometric authentication

Risks of Using Mobile Banking Apps

While mobile banking apps offer many benefits, there are also some risks that users should be aware of, including:

  • Security risks, such as hacking and data breaches
  • Phishing scams and social engineering attacks
  • Lost or stolen devices that can provide access to your financial information
  • Technical glitches and errors that can result in incorrect transactions

Best Practices for Using Mobile Banking Apps

To minimize the risks associated with using mobile banking apps, it’s important to follow best practices, such as:

  • Using strong and unique passwords for each app and changing them regularly
  • Keeping your device’s operating system and apps up-to-date with the latest security patches
  • Avoiding using public Wi-Fi networks when accessing your mobile banking app
  • Enabling two-factor authentication for added security
  • Checking your account activity regularly for suspicious transactions

Security Risks

One of the biggest risks associated with using mobile banking apps is the potential for security breaches. In 2020, there were over 3,000 data breaches reported, exposing over 37 billion records. While not all of these breaches were related to mobile banking, they serve as a reminder that security is a critical concern when using any type of online service. To protect yourself, make sure you use strong passwords, enable two-factor authentication, and avoid sharing personal information with anyone you don’t trust.

Phishing Scams

Phishing scams are another common risk associated with mobile banking apps. These scams typically involve a hacker posing as a trusted source, such as a bank representative, and asking for personal or financial information. To avoid falling for these scams, always verify the identity of anyone who requests sensitive information, and never provide personal or financial information over the phone or email.

Technical Glitches and Errors

Technical glitches and errors can also be a risk when using mobile banking apps. While these issues are usually minor and quickly resolved, they can result in incorrect transactions or other issues that can impact your financial health. To minimize the risk of technical glitches, make sure you keep your mobile device and apps up-to-date with the latest security patches and fixes.

Conclusion

Mobile banking apps offer many benefits and are a convenient way to manage your finances. However, it’s important to be aware of the risks associated with using these apps and to take steps to protect your financial information. By following best practices and staying vigilant, you can enjoy the benefits of mobile banking apps while minimizing the risks.
